118th Congress Gets Underway

After 15 ballots, the U.S. House of Representatives elected its new Speaker of the House, Kevin McCarthy (R-CA) late last Friday evening and this week began organizing key committees. On Tuesday, Representative Jason Smith (R-MO) was selected as the new Chairman of the House Ways & Means Committee, which has oversight over trade policy. The committee also named its newest Republican members for the 118th Congress:   Representatives Mike Carey (OH-15), Randy Feenstra (IA-04), Michelle Fischbach (MN-07), Brian Fitzpatrick (PA-01), Nicole Malliotakis (NY-11), Blake Moore (UT-01), Michelle Steel (CA-45), Greg Steube (FL-17), Claudia Tenney (NY-24) and Beth Van Duyne (TX-24).  Democrats have yet to announce their committee members, however Representative Richard Neal (D-MA) is expected to continue in his leadership role as Ranking Member. The Senate met on Tuesday, January 3rd and was sworn in, but has since recessed until the week of January 23rd.            

Biden Administration

This week the Biden Administration unveiled what it called a roadmap for the decarbonization of the transportation sector.  The U.S. National Blueprint for Transportation Decarbonization, which was developed by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and Departments of Energy, Transportation, and Housing and Urban Development, is intended to support President Joe Biden’s climate goals.

Clean Vehicle Tax Credit

The IRS has started compiling a list of the clean vehicles that *may* qualify for the credit, subject to new MSRP and consumer income caps. The CVTC, authorized by the Inflation Reduction Act, provides a credit of up to $7,500 for electric and fuel cell vehicles with final assembly in North America, but with stringent new, and annually increasing, battery requirements which, depending upon implementation, could exclude many EVs currently sold in the U.S. Late last year, the IRS said it would delay the release of guidance on new battery requirements until March.
